New Delhi , 15 Feb 2016

The Union Home Minister, Rajnath Singh chaired a meeting of the High Level Committee (HLC) here today for Central Assistance to States affected by drought. The Union Minister for Finance, Corporate Affairs and Information and Broadcasting Shri Arun Jaitley, Union Home Secretary Shri Rajiv Mehrishi and senior officers of the Ministries of Home, Finance and Agriculture attended the meeting. The Committee examined the proposals based on the report of the Central Team which visited the affected states by severe drought. The HLC approved the assistance from the National Disaster Relief Fund (NDRF) in respect of Assam to the tune of Rs 332.57 crore, Rs. 336.94 crore for Jharkhand and Rs. 1,193.41 crore for Rajasthan. The HLC also approved the assistance from NDRF in respect of Andhra Pradesh to the tune of Rs 280.19 crore besides Rs.9.00 crore from Special component of National Rural Drinking Water Programee (NRDWP) for repair of damaged rural drinking water supply works, Rs.170.19 crore for Himachal Pradesh and another Rs.12.00 crore from NRDWP and Rs 16.02 crore for Nagaland besides Rs.4.00 crore from NRDWP and Rs.1,737.65 crore for Tamil Nadu and Rs.32.00 crore from NRDWP.
